    A couple of the pictures were of the Cathedral of Christ the Savior, which was blown up under Stalin, and what was, reputedly, the world's largest swimming pool was then built on the site, IIRC.

    Now the Cathedral has been rebuilt, and looks just like the old photos of the original, except brighter, so not all of the Stalin-era cultural destruction was final, which is nice.

    After the Berlin Castle got bombarded to shit during the war, East Germany chose not to rebuild it but to build the civic center of the nation, the Palace of the Republic, where it once stood.

    After reunification, West German capitalists demolished the Palace of the Republic and replaced it with a replica of the feudal Berlin castle. The steel from the civic center was sold to Dubai wahhabis for the construction of the latest monument to their capitalist decadence, that half-mile high skyscraper.
